Exploding dinner
Last night, I made us enchiladas for dinner. These were my best attempt ever, filled with black olives, extra sharp cheddar cheese, and a blend of chili and garlic powder. I topped them with more olives, jalapenos, the powder blend, cheese, and sauce. These enchiladas were a labor of love. We sat down to eat dinner in the living room, leaving the tray on the stovetop. I decided to boil some water for tea. When I did that, I turned on the wrong burner. Yes, I turned on the burner under the pan. A little while later we heard a terrible crash in the kitchen. I thought the cats had knocked over some beads. Nope. The remainder of the enchiladas exploded all over the kitchen, resulting in glass shards and enchiladas bits everywhere. This made me so sad. I am a disaster sometimes.
